~lubuntu-software-center-team/lubuntu-software-center/lubuntu-software-center-trunk

« back to all changes in this revision

Viewing changes to src/UI.py

  • Committer: Julien Lavergne
  • Date: 2015-02-17 21:15:49 UTC
  • Revision ID: gilir@ubuntu.com-20150217211549-h5opurt5r1ayo3ps
Tags: 0.0.10
ReleaseĀ 0.0.10

Show diffs side-by-side

added added

removed removed

Lines of Context:
49
49
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A  02110-1301, USA.
50
50
'''
51
51
 
 
52
import os
52
53
import sys
53
54
from . import LOG
54
55
 
79
80
            ("gtk-harddisk", _("Installed Software"), "inst"),
80
81
            ("applications-other", _("Apps Basket"), "basket")
81
82
        ]
82
 
        self.toolbar = toolbar.Toolbar()
 
83
 
 
84
        if os.environ.get('XDG_CURRENT_DESKTOP') == 'GNOME':
 
85
            self.toolbar = toolbar.Headerbar()
 
86
            self.set_titlebar(self.toolbar)
 
87
        else:
 
88
            self.toolbar = toolbar.Toolbar()
 
89
 
83
90
        self.pages.sections = self.toolbar.add_sections(
84
91
            self.sections, True, self.pages.change_section)
85
92
        self.categories_button_dict = self.pages.categories.append_sections(
94
101
        self.search_pkg = self.toolbar.entry
95
102
        self.vbox = Gtk.VBox()
96
103
        self.vbox1 = Gtk.VBox()
97
 
        #self.vbox1.set_border_width(5)
98
 
        #self.vbox1.set_spacing(5)
99
 
        self.vbox.pack_start(self.toolbar, False, False, 0)
 
104
 
 
105
        if os.environ.get('XDG_CURRENT_DESKTOP') != 'GNOME':
 
106
            self.vbox.pack_start(self.toolbar, False, False, 0)
 
107
        else:
 
108
            self.vbox.pack_start(self.toolbar.searchbar, False, False, 0)
100
109
        self.vbox.pack_start(self.vbox1, True, True, 0)
101
110
        self.vbox1.pack_start(self.statusbox, False, False, 0)
102
111
        self.vbox1.pack_start(self.pages, True, True, 0)